Output df03bcc3f17094864652d56ce727748a323df5c3eefcfcff60a4f98219bad71f:0

value
169064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2301f6a3a7e46b0c6a2623d88572a94f215105a OP_EQUAL
address
3KPnfPCyoGEK4Lnxa3CxwEV7tiRPQSPo75
transaction
df03bcc3f17094864652d56ce727748a323df5c3eefcfcff60a4f98219bad71f
confirmations
135088
spent
true